Step-by-step explanation:
f(x) = (-2x² + 14)/(x² - 49)
x² - 49 = (x + 7)(x - 7)
Hence f(x) goes to infinity at x = - 7 or 7
x < - 7 = (-ve)(-ve) = + ve
=> x → –7–
Here, x² - 49 is + ve
-7 < x < 7 = (+ve)(-ve) = - ve
=> x → –7+ or x → 7– .
here, x² - 49 is - ve
x > 7 = (+ve)(+ve) = + ve
=> x → 7+
Here, x² - 49 is + ve
So (-2x² + 14) is - ve for all [ x → –7– , x → –7+ , x → 7– , x → 7+ ]
As,
-2(-7)² + 14 = -84 and -2(+7)² + 14 = -84
x → –7– = (-ve)/(+ve)
=> y → -[infinity].
x → –7+ or x → 7– = (-ve)/(-ve)
=> y → [infinity]
x → 7+ = (-ve)/(+ve)
=> y → -[infinity].
x → 7+, y → –[infinity]. is the correct option

The new crew works at the rate 1/12 apt/hr.
The old crew works at the rate 1/6 apt/hr.
Let x = hours required to paint the apartment when the two crews work together.
That is,
(1/12 + 1/6 apt/hr)*(x hr) = (1 apt)
(3/12)x = 1
(1/4)x = 1
x = 4 hours
Answer: 4 hours
